Arsenal have three of the best top 10 young talents in world football, according to online scouting database Football Talent Scout.

Gabriel Martinelli, Bukayo Saka and William Saliba have all been named as some of the top young talents on the planet – which bodes well for the future for the north Londoners.

The survey lists 19-year-old Saliba in tenth place, with starlet Saka a slot higher in ninth, with the prodigious 18-year-old Martinelli sixth on the list of world football’s top 50 teenagers.

The talented Saka and Martinelli could save Arsenal millions in the transfer market if they continue to make progress and stay at the club long term to boost chances of silverware under Arteta in the future. 

Saka’s emergence has been stark considering he was playing for Freddie Ljungberg’s U21 academy side in the Checkatrade Trophy last season, while Brazilian teen Martinelli has excelled after arriving from Sao Paolo side Ituano after playing in the Campeonato Paulista this time last year.

While much is expected of defender Saliba when he joins Arsenal from Saint Etienne imminently - after signing for the Gunners last summer, only to be loaned back for a year.

The listing is a boost to the Gunners, struggling with finances before the coronavirus pandemic halted football – with the lack of matchday and TV revenues during lockdown prompting the club to ask the Mikel Arteta’s squad to take a 12.5 per cent pay cut – with the vast majority agreeing.

The club are on the lookout for cut-price bargains while aiming to land talented youngsters such as Dennis Gyamfi and George Lewis.

However, it is the young tyros already at the club in Saka and Martinelli that provide real hope for the future for Arsenal supporters - as Arteta’s squad aim to finish as high up the table as and when the 2019-20 Premier League season resumes.

The top 50 youngsters on the planet as chosen by scouting database Football Talent Scout

  1. Rayan Cherki (FRA, 2003, attacking midfielder, Olympique Lyon)
  2. Eduardo Camavinga (FRA, 2002, defensive midfielder, Rennes)
  3. Mason Greenwood (ENG, 2001, striker, Manchester United)
  4. Mohamed Ihattaren (NED, 2002, attacking midfielder, PSV Eindhoven)
  5. Rodrygo (BRA, 2001, winger, Real Madrid)
  6. Gabriel Martinelli (BRA, 2001, striker, Arsenal)
  7. Reinier (BRA, 2002, attacking midfielder, Real Madrid)
  8. Ansu Fati (ESP, 2002, winger, FC Barcelona)
  9. Bukayo Saka (ENG, 2001, left-back, Arsenal)
  10. William Saliba (FRA, 2001, centre-back, Arsenal)
  11. Billy Gilmour (SCO, 2001, central midfielder, Chelsea)
  12. Myron Boadu (NED, 2001, striker, AZ Alkmaar)
  13. Adil Aouchiche (FRA, 2002, central midfielder, PSG)
  14. Jude Bellingham (ENG, 2003, central midfielder, Birmingham)
  15. Thiago Almada (ARG, 2001, second striker, Velez)
  16. Tanguy Kouassi (FRA, 2002, centre-back, PSG)
  17. Pedri (ESP, 2002, winger, Las Palmas/FC Barcelona)
  18. Eric Garcia (ESP, 2001, centre-back, Manchester City)
  19. Sebastiano Esposito (ITA, 2002, striker, Inter)
  20. Naci Ünüvar (NED, 2003, attacking midfielder, Ajax Amsterdam)
  21. Giovanni Reyna (USA, 2002, attacking midfielder, BVB)
  22. Fábio Silva (POR, 2002, striker, FC Porto)
  23. Talles Magno (BRA, 2002, winger, Vasco)
  24. Robert Navarro (ESP, 2002, attacking midfielder, Real Sociedad)
  25. Karim Adeyemi (GER, 2002, striker, RB Salzburg)
  26. João Pedro (BRA, 2001, striker, Watford)
  27. Takefusa Kubo (JPN, 2001, winger, Real Madrid)
  28. Ronaldo Camará (POR, 2003, central midfielder, Benfica)
  29. Yari Verschaeren (BEL, 2001, attacking midfielder, Anderlecht)
  30. Ryan Gravenberch (NED, 2002, central midfielder, Ajax Amsterdam)
  31. Filip Stevanovi? (SRB, 2002, winger, Partizan)
  32. Gabriel Veron (BRA, 2002, winger, Palmeiras)
  33. Hannibal Mejbri (FRA, 2003, central midfielder, Manchester United)
  34. Darío Sarmiento (ARG, 2003, winger, Estudiantes)
  35. James Garner (ENG, 2001, defensive midfielder, Manchester United)
  36. Adam Hlozek (CZE, 2002, striker, Sparta Prague)
  37. Jérémy Doku (BEL, 2002, winger, Anderlecht)
  38. Kang-in Lee (KOR, 2001, attacking midfielder, Valencia)
  39. Benoît Badiashile (FRA, 2001, centre-back, AS Monaco)
  40. Joelson Fernandes (POR, 2003, winger, Sporting CP)
  41. Israel Salazar (ESP, 2003, striker, Real Madrid)
  42. Ilaix Moriba (ESP, 2003, central midfielder, FC Barcelona)
  43. Matías Palacios (ARG, 2002, attacking midfielder, San Lorenzo)
  44. Lucien Agoume (FRA, 2002, defensive midfielder, Inter)
  45. Joshua Zirkzee (NED, 2001, striker, Bayern)
  46. Kacper Koz?owski (POL, 2003, central midfielder, Pogo? Szczecin)
  47. Eduardo Quaresma (POR, 2002, centre-back, Sporting CP)
  48. Curtis Jones (ENG, 2001, central midfielder, Liverpool)
  49. Strahinja Pavlovi? (SRB, 2001, centre-back, Partizan)
  50. Victor Mollejo (ESP, 2001, winger, Atletico Madrid
